Which Federal Reserve district serve the largest number of states>
A
Cleveland
B
Atlanta
C
Dallas
D
San Francisco
Explanation: 

Detailed explanation-1: -San Francisco is the headquarters of the Twelfth Federal Reserve District, which includes the nine western states-Alaska, Arizona, California, Hawaii, Idaho, Nevada, Oregon, Utah, and Washington-plus American Samoa, Guam, and the Commonwealth of the Northern Mariana Islands.
